Excel删除数据库技巧,如何快速高效操作?
在 Excel 表格中删除“数据库”数据,主要有以下3种方法:**1、使用筛选和删除功能;2、利用查找与替换批量清除;3、通过VBA脚本自动处理。**其中,最常用且操作简便的方法是第一种——筛选并删除。用户可以通过Excel的“筛选”功能快速定位包含“数据库”关键字的行或单元格,然后批量选中并执行删除操作。这种方式适合大部分日常办公需求,既无需复杂技能,也能有效提高数据整理效率。下面将详细介绍这些方法及其适用场景,并特别展开第一种方法的具体操作步骤。
《excel表格中如何删除数据库数据库》
一、EXCEL表格中删除数据库数据的常用方法
在实际工作中,我们经常需要清理Excel表格中的特定数据,比如包含“数据库”字样的信息。以下是三种主流方法及其对比:
| 方法 | 适用场景 | 优缺点 |
|---|---|---|
| 1. 筛选+手动删除 | 数据量较小,需人工确认的数据 | 操作直观简单,灵活性高,但效率一般 |
| 2. 查找与替换 | 大规模关键词批量处理 | 快速高效,但可能误删无关内容 |
| 3. VBA脚本自动处理 | 定期自动化清理,大批量复杂场景 | 批量处理强大,但需一定编程基础 |
二、筛选并手动删除——最实用的方法详解
1. 操作步骤如下:
- 选中含有“数据库”字段的数据区域(通常是整个表格)。
- 点击顶部菜单栏的【数据】→【筛选】按钮,为每一列添加筛选箭头。
- 在相关列点击下拉箭头,选择文本筛选,如“包含”,输入“数据库”,确认。
- 筛选结果即为所有含有“数据库”的行,全选这些行后右键选择【删除行】或【清除内容】。
- 取消筛选,即可看到不再包含目标字段的数据表。
2. 优势分析:
这种方式最大好处在于直观和可控,适合需要人工判断和交互确认时使用。例如,人力资源部门定期清理员工信息时,只想去除备注里带有“数据库”的条目,而不是全部字段,这时就可以灵活运用此法。
三、查找并替换功能——高效批量清理
当需要快速查找所有包含某个关键词(如:“数据库”)的单元格并进行统一处理时,可使用查找与替换:
操作流程如下:
- 按下快捷键
Ctrl+F打开查找对话框; - 切换到【替换】标签页;
- 在【查找内容】输入“数据库”,
- 【替换为】留空,如果只想清除内容;
- 点击【全部替换】,即可一次性移除所有相关字段。
注意事项:
- 替换前建议先备份文件,以防误删重要信息。
- 如果只想删除整行,应结合定位和手动操作,不建议直接全表替换。
四、VBA脚本自动化——高级用户首选
对于开发者或者IT管理员来说,通过VBA脚本可实现更复杂、更高效的数据清理逻辑。例如,可以一键遍历所有工作表,将包含指定关键词的整行或指定单元格内容全部剔除。
Sub DeleteRowsWithKeyword()Dim ws As WorksheetDim rng As Range, cell As RangeDim lastRow As Long, i As Long
For Each ws In ThisWorkbook.Worksheetslast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row ' 假设A列为目标列For i = lastRow To 1 Step -1If InStr(ws.Cells(i, "A").Value, "数据库") > 0 Thenws.Rows(i).DeleteEnd IfNext iNext wsEnd Sub说明:
- 可根据实际需求调整检测范围(如某列或全表)。
- 脚本运行前务必备份原始文件!
五、“简道云”等零代码平台赋能业务自动化
如果你希望无需编写任何代码,实现类似Excel数据智能管理、更高级的数据流转推荐试试 零代码开发平台——简道云(官网地址 )。 简道云支持拖拽式搭建各类业务系统,包括数据导入、智能过滤与批量处理等功能,非常适合对技术门槛敏感的企业用户:
| 功能模块 | 支持情况 | 优势 |
|---|---|---|
| 数据导入导出 | 一键上传/下载 | 无需格式转换,多格式兼容 |
| 智能过滤 | 图形界面规则配置 | 灵活设置条件,无需写公式 |
| 批量处理 | 多条件触发动作 | 自动执行,无人工干预 |
| 权限控制 | 多级分配 | 保证敏感信息安全 |
通过简道云,你可以把Excel中的原始表格一键导入,再利用其内置流程规则实现“不含‘数据库’关键词即保留,否则自动剔除”,极大减轻人力负担,并提升准确性和合规性。
六、原因分析与应用建议
为什么要掌握这些Excel数据清洗技巧?
- 效率提升:面对大量杂乱信息时,高效定位和剔除无关/敏感条目,是保证报告质量和业务决策可靠性的基础。
- 降低出错率:手工逐项核查容易遗漏,通过工具或平台辅助可以最大程度避免遗漏或误删。
- 满足合规要求:部分行业(如金融、人力资源等)须定期审计和净化历史数据,与隐私保护法规接轨。
如果你的团队频繁遇到类似需求,建议:
- 小规模可直接用Excel自带工具解决;
- 大规模复杂场景优先考虑流程自动化平台如简道云;
- 有IT资源也可开发专属VBA宏脚本实现高度定制化。
七、小结与行动建议
总结来看,要在Excel中有效地删除含有特定关键字(如“数据库”)的数据,可以根据实际场景选择最恰当的方法。对于普通用户推荐利用筛选+手动删除,对于大批量则可尝试批量查找/替换或者VBA脚本。如果希望彻底摆脱繁琐劳动,实现企业级云端智能管理,不妨注册体验简道云零代码开发平台: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c
最后推荐:100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
Excel表格中如何删除数据库数据?
我在使用Excel管理数据库时,想知道如何删除不需要的数据。有没有简单又高效的方法在Excel表格中进行数据库数据删除?
在Excel表格中删除数据库数据,可以通过以下几种方式实现:
- 手动删除行或列:直接选中需要删除的行或列,右键选择“删除”,适合少量数据操作。
- 使用筛选功能批量删除:应用筛选条件,筛选出目标数据后,选中所有筛选结果进行删除。
- 利用VBA宏自动化删除:编写VBA代码根据条件批量清除指定的数据,提高处理效率,适合大规模数据操作。
例如,使用筛选功能可以快速定位并删除超过一定日期的数据。根据微软统计,合理利用筛选功能可以提升数据处理效率30%以上。
如何防止误删Excel表格中的数据库数据?
我经常担心在Excel中操作时误删了重要的数据库记录,有什么方法可以避免这种情况发生吗?
防止误删数据库数据,可以采取以下措施:
| 方法 | 说明 |
|---|---|
| 数据备份 | 定期保存文件副本,以便恢复误删内容 |
| 使用保护工作表 | 设置密码保护,只允许特定区域编辑 |
| 利用撤销功能 | 操作后立即撤销错误步骤 |
| 应用数据验证 | 限制单元格输入范围,减少错误修改风险 |
例如,通过启用工作表保护,可以锁定关键字段,仅允许输入特定格式的数据,有效降低误删概率。据调查,此类措施可以减少70%的人为错误。
Excel中如何通过条件快速定位并删除特定数据库记录?
我需要根据某些条件,比如日期或数值范围,在Excel里批量定位并删除符合条件的数据库记录,有没有快捷方法可以实现?
快速定位并删除特定记录的步骤如下:
- 应用自动筛选:点击“数据”菜单中的“筛选”,设置过滤条件(如日期大于某天)。
- 选择筛选结果:筛选后只显示符合条件的行,全选这些行。
- 执行删除操作:右键选择“删除行”,完成批量清理。
示例场景:若需清除2023年以前的数据,可设置日期列小于“2023-01-01”的过滤条件。一项实测显示,通过此方法可将处理时间缩短至传统手动查找的20%。
使用VBA宏如何在Excel表格中自动化删除数据库记录?
我听说用VBA宏能自动化处理大量Excel数据,包括批量删库。我对编写宏不太了解,可以介绍下如何用VBA实现吗?
利用VBA宏自动化删除步骤示例:
Sub DeleteRowsByCondition() Dim i As Long For i = Cells(Rows.Count, "A").End(xlUp).Row To 2 Step -1 If Cells(i, "A").Value < DateSerial(2023, 1, 1) Then '按日期判断 Rows(i).Delete End If Next iEnd Sub说明:此代码从底向上遍历第A列,如果日期早于2023年1月1日,则整行被删除。
案例效果显示,使用该宏可将数万条记录的批量清理时间从数小时缩减至几分钟,提高效率超过90%。此外,通过调整判断条件,可灵活应对各种业务需求。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/85428/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。